Background & Context
For decades, car manufacturers have been working to improve the safety and efficiency of their vehicles. One of the most significant advances in recent years has been the widespread adoption of LED headlights. These high-tech lights use light-emitting diodes (LEDs) to produce a beam of light that is not only brighter than traditional halogen headlights but also more focused and energy-efficient.
However, as with any new technology, there are potential drawbacks to consider. In the case of LED headlights, the main concern is that they are simply too bright. While they may improve visibility for the driver, they can also create a glare that is so intense that it is difficult for other drivers to see. This is particularly true on dark, hilly, or curved roads, where the beam of light from the LED headlights can be amplified by the surrounding terrain.
Key Details
So, why are LED headlights so much brighter than older headlights? The answer lies in the way that they produce light. Unlike traditional halogen headlights, which use a filament to produce a beam of light, LED headlights use a series of small diodes to create a much more focused beam. This not only makes them more energy-efficient but also allows them to produce a beam of light that is much more like daylight.
The fixed optics and higher color temperature of LED headlights, which can reach up to **15,000K**, are also a key factor in their increased brightness. This means that they are not only more efficient but also more effective at lighting up road signs and dark roads. However, as we will see, this increased brightness can also be a major drawback.
One of the reasons that manufacturers have switched to LED headlights is that they are more efficient and longer-lasting than traditional halogen headlights. In fact, LEDs typically draw only **15 to 30 Watts** per headlight module, compared to the **55 to 65 Watts** required by halogen bulbs. This not only reduces the amount of power required to run the headlights but also reduces the amount of heat that is generated.
